The "Liberal" Conspirators (Who, You All Know, Are Honorable Men).
"O let us have him; for his silver hair / will purchase us a good opinion / and buy men's voice to commend our deeds / it shall be said, his judgment rul'd our hands; / our youths, and wildness, shall no wit appear, / but all be buried in his gravity" -- Julius Ceasar.
